Project

General

Profile

Issue with Sigma 17-70 lens mounted on a canon

Added by Philippe Midol-Monnet over 5 years ago

Hi

The Sigma 17-70mm f/2.8-4 DC Macro OS HSM is not correctly detected. Instead we got Canon EF 500mm f/4L IS.

Therefore I modified canonmn.cpp by adding two lines

line 740: { 143, "Sigma 17-70mm f/2.8-4 DC Macro OS HSM" }, // 1
line 946: { 143, printCsLensByFocalLength },

Now the lens is detected.

Regards

Philippe


Replies (4)

RE: Issue with Sigma 17-70 lens mounted on a canon - Added by Robin Mills over 5 years ago

Thank you, Philippe. I've registered this as #1167 Thanks for the patch, I'll review/test and submit it tomorrow.

RE: Issue with Sigma 17-70 lens mounted on a canon - Added by Robin Mills over 5 years ago

Philippe

Can you provide a test file for this please? I'll extract the metadata from your test file and add it to our test suite. As well as confirming that your patch works, the test suite has a regression detector should your patch break at some time in the future.

Robin

RE: Issue with Sigma 17-70 lens mounted on a canon - Added by Robin Mills over 5 years ago

Thanks, Philippe. I submitted your patches for #1166 and #1167 yesterday. I'll update the test suite tomorrow with the metadata from your test file. Thanks very much for providing this.

    (1-4/4)